CVE-2008-1945 – qemu/kvm/xen: add image format options for USB storage and removable media
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2008-1945
08 Aug 2008 — QEMU 0.9.0 does not properly handle changes to removable media, which allows guest OS users to read arbitrary files on the host OS by using the diskformat: parameter in the -usbdevice option to modify the disk-image header to identify a different format, a related issue to CVE-2008-2004. CVE-2008-2004 – qemu/kvm/xen: qemu block format auto-detection vulnerability
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2008-2004
12 May 2008 — The drive_init function in QEMU 0.9.1 determines the format of a raw disk image based on the header, which allows local guest users to read arbitrary files on the host by modifying the header to identify a different format, which is used when the guest is restarted. CVE-2008-0928 – Qemu insufficient block device address range checking
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2008-0928
03 Mar 2008 — Qemu 0.9.1 and earlier does not perform range checks for block device read or write requests, which allows guest host users with root privileges to access arbitrary memory and escape the virtual machine. CVE-2007-6227 – QEMU 0.9 - Translation Block Local Denial of Service
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2007-6227
04 Dec 2007 — QEMU 0.9.0 allows local users of a Windows XP SP2 guest operating system to overwrite the TranslationBlock (code_gen_buffer) buffer, and probably have unspecified other impacts related to an "overflow," via certain Windows executable programs, as demonstrated by qemu-dos.com. CVE-2007-5729
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2007-5729
30 Oct 2007 — The NE2000 emulator in QEMU 0.8.2 allows local users to execute arbitrary code by writing Ethernet frames with a size larger than the MTU to the EN0_TCNT register, which triggers a heap-based buffer overflow in the slirp library, aka NE2000 "mtu" heap overflow. NOTE: some sources have used CVE-2007-1321 to refer to this issue as part of "NE2000 network driver and the socket code," but this is the correct identifier for the mtu overflow vulnerability. CVE-2007-1321 – xen QEMU NE2000 emulation issues
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2007-1321
30 Oct 2007 — Integer signedness error in the NE2000 emulator in QEMU 0.8.2, as used in Xen and possibly other products, allows local users to trigger a heap-based buffer overflow via certain register values that bypass sanity checks, aka QEMU NE2000 "receive" integer signedness error. CVE-2007-5730 – QEMU Buffer overflow via crafted "net socket listen" option
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2007-5730
30 Oct 2007 — Heap-based buffer overflow in QEMU 0.8.2, as used in Xen and possibly other products, allows local users to execute arbitrary code via crafted data in the "net socket listen" option, aka QEMU "net socket" heap overflow. NOTE: some sources have used CVE-2007-1321 to refer to this issue as part of "NE2000 network driver and the socket code," but this is the correct identifier for the individual net socket listen vulnerability. CVE-2007-1320 – xen/qemu Cirrus LGD-54XX "bitblt" Heap Overflow
https://notcve.org/view.php?id=CVE-2007-1320
02 May 2007 — Multiple heap-based buffer overflows in the cirrus_invalidate_region function in the Cirrus VGA extension in QEMU 0.8.2, as used in Xen and possibly other products, might allow local users to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ors related to "attempting to mark non-existent regions as dirty," aka the "bitblt" heap overflow.
